Subject: Proposed Vantor Plus Subscription Tier

Dear Executive Team,

Following three months of customer research, we propose launching Vantor Plus, a mid-range tier positioned between Starter and Enterprise. Projected uptake suggests a 12% revenue lift within two quarters, with minimal cannibalization of Enterprise accounts. Pricing, packaging, and migration paths have been reviewed by Finance and Legal. Full modeling is attached for your review. The strategic rationale behind this timing is summarized below.

board note of fahif-yahog: Gross margin on Wenath came in at 10 percent against a plan of 5 percent. Only 3 of the 100 pilot accounts renewed Wenath, so a churn review is set for July 15.

Alert: TAXCACHE_STALE (Ledgerbird). Fires when the tax-rate lookup cache has not refreshed in 6 hours. Checkout falls back to live lookups, adding latency and risking rate mismatches at quarter boundaries. Check the refresh job's last run and the upstream rates feed health. If the feed is down, extend cache TTL per the mitigation playbook. Force a refresh only after confirming feed integrity, per the page below.

runbook for taduf-kawef: https://confluence.qorvelsys.internal/projects/display/display/pages

Heads up for anyone new: the tailcat CLI stopped streaming logs this morning because its credential for the Driftlog service expired. Reinstalling won't fix it. Update your local config with the replacement credential and restart any open sessions. The new key issued by the platform team is below.

service key, fajof-fahaf: vxb3-dv3